The Fayette County Board of Commissioners and the Fayette County Board of Education have scheduled called meetings for Monday.

The commission will meet in executive session at 9:30 a.m. at the Administrative Complex at 140 Stonewall Ave. West in Fayetteville. The school board will hold an executive session at 2 p.m. at its office at 210 Stonewall Ave. West.

No details have been provided regarding the agendas, but both entities are currently involved in a federal lawsuit against the NAACP regarding at-large vs. district voting for electing representatives of both boards.
